Condividi tramite


Eventi ETW di interoperabilità

Gli eventi di interoperabilità acquisiscono informazioni sulla generazione dello stub e la memorizzazione nella cache di Microsoft Intermediate Language (MSIL).

Questa categoria è costituita dagli eventi riportati di seguito:

  • Evento ILStubGenerated

  • Evento ILStubCacheHit

Evento ILStubGenerated

Nella tabella seguente vengono riportate le parole chiave e il livello. Per ulteriori informazioni, vedere Parole chiave e livelli ETW di CLR.

Parola chiave per la generazione dell'evento

Livello

InteropKeyword (0x2000)

Informational(4)

Nella tabella riportata di seguito vengono illustrate le informazioni sull'evento.

Evento

ID evento

Condizione di generazione

ILStubGenerated

88

Lo stub MSIL è stato generato.

Nella tabella riportata di seguito vengono illustrati i dati relativi all'evento.

Nome campo

Tipo di dati

Descrizione

ModuleID

win:UInt16

Identificatore del modulo.

StubMethodID

win:UInt64

Identificatore del metodo stub.

StubFlags

win:UInt64

Flag per lo stub:

0x1 - Interoperabilità inversa.

0x2 - Interoperabilità COM.

0x4 - Stub generato da NGen.exe.

0x8 - Delegato.

0x10 - Argomento variabile.

0x20 - Metodo chiamato non gestito.

ManagedInteropMethodToken

win:UInt32

Token per il metodo di interoperabilità gestito.

ManagedInteropMethodNameSpace

win:UnicodeString

Spazio dei nomi del metodo di interoperabilità gestito.

ManagedInteropMethodName

win:UnicodeString

Nome del metodo di interoperabilità gestito.

ManagedInteropMethodSignature

win:UnicodeString

Firma del metodo di interoperabilità gestito.

NativeMethodSignature

win:UnicodeString

Firma del metodo nativo.

StubMethodSignature

win:UnicodeString

Firma del metodo stub.

StubMethodILCode

win:UnicodeString

Codice MSIL per il metodo stub.

ClrInstanceID

win:UInt16

ID univoco dell'istanza di CLR o CoreCLR.

Torna all'inizio

Evento ILStubCacheHit

Nella tabella seguente vengono riportate le parole chiave e il livello.

Parola chiave per la generazione dell'evento

Livello

InteropKeyword (0x2000)

Informational(4)

Nella tabella riportata di seguito vengono illustrate le informazioni sull'evento.

Evento

ID evento

Condizione di generazione

ILStubCacheHit

89

L'accesso alla cache MSIL è stato eseguito.

Nella tabella riportata di seguito vengono illustrati i dati relativi all'evento.

Nome campo

Tipo di dati

Descrizione

ModuleID

win:UInt16

Identificatore del modulo.

StubMethodID

win:UInt64

Identificatore del metodo stub.

ManagedInteropMethodToken

win:UInt32

Token per il metodo di interoperabilità gestito.

ManagedInteropMethodNameSpace

win:UnicodeString

Spazio dei nomi del metodo di interoperabilità gestito.

ManagedInteropMethodName

win:UnicodeString

Nome del metodo di interoperabilità gestito.

ManagedInteropMethodSignature

win:UnicodeString

Firma del metodo di interoperabilità gestito.

ClrInstanceID

win:UInt16

ID univoco dell'istanza di CLR o CoreCLR.

Torna all'inizio

Vedere anche

Concetti

Eventi ETW di CLR